La Furieuse is a productive river in the Doubs department offering excellent opportunities for anglers targeting carp, catfish, zander, pike, bream, and perch across its varied stretches. This waterway permits night fishing and welcomes boats, making it ideal for both traditional and contemporary fishing methods, while bivouac and camping facilities allow for extended fishing trips. A Carte de Peche (annual fishing licence obtainable through the local AAPPMA federation) is required to fish these waters.

To fish La Furieuse, you need a valid Carte de Pêche, available from cartedepeche.fr before you leave the UK and affiliation with the local AAPPMA covering this stretch. Annual, weekly and daily licences are all available online.
